Pairing it with your wireless receiver or Katana-Air is also a breeze. Just dock them together for about 10 seconds, and the WL-T does all the work for you.

Do you have a smartphone? Do you know how to charge it? Of course you do. Well, charging the WL-T is just as easy. Simply dock it to your wireless receiver or Katana-Air, and you're good to go. You can also charge the WL-T individually via the included micro USB cable.

The WL-T works with the following BOSS wireless products:
WL-20, WL-20L, WL-50, KATANA-AIR and WAZA-AIR
Note: The WL-T has no audio functionality as a standalone device. To transmit sound, it must be used in conjunction with the wireless receiver in one of the products listed above.
